I mean Montreal isn't any more of a playoff team next year than they are this year, so I'd probably take the 2025 pick over 2024 considering it's a better draft.


While that's true, that's not worth taking on Anderson for. Necas gets strangled by Rod's system and in another free flowing offense instead of the "point shots and pray for deflections" Brind'amour wants, he's going to flourish. Especially on a team that will let him play as a center. Montreal are desperate for help up the middle, and Necas has a campaign of wanting to play down the middle that may as well be Roman because he's not giving up.

Trevor Zegras is not on the market, and I don't believe that the similar-value Martin Necas is, either, but if they were, neither offer is close for them.

It would take your own 2024 first plus an A prospect like Owen Beck or Filip Mesar to persuade their team to part with either.

Barron probably tops out at second-pair RhD and Kapanen and Ylonen are bottom-6 wingers; it's not clear to me that Ylonen is even worth his Qualifying Offer. You're the first person who's ever used the word "speedy" to describe Josh Anderson, and the two B prospects in THAT offer are no more impressive than Kapanen and Ylonen. Castoffs like that don't get you top-6 forwards like Necas and Zegras, both of whom are comparable to Cole Caufield and each of whom had far better starts to their careers than Juraj Slafkovsky.
